
What is hospital indemnity insurance, and how does it work?
Hospital indemnity insurance is a supplemental plan that provides seniors with cash benefits during hospital stays. Unlike traditional health insurance, which pays providers directly, hospital indemnity delivers funds to the policyholder. is hospital indemnity insurance worth it ? These cash benefits can be used for medical bills, copays, deductibles, transportation, home support, and other recovery-related expenses, offering seniors flexibility and financial security.

Does hospital indemnity complement traditional health insurance?
Yes. Hospital indemnity is designed to supplement—not replace—existing health coverage. While insurance addresses medical treatments, indemnity plans provide cash for out-of-pocket and indirect expenses, creating a more comprehensive safety net for seniors.
Are the benefits predictable and easy to access?
Most hospital indemnity plans provide predetermined cash payouts for qualifying hospital events. Seniors can plan ahead knowing the exact financial support available and access funds quickly when needed. This predictability simplifies budgeting and reduces stress during hospitalization and recovery.
